| Sumario: | An interview with publisher Seth Siegelaub is presented. When asked about the growing issue concerning issuance of contract for having a gallery, he admitted the compressive version of lawyer Bob Projansky which worked towards the development of artists' professionalism. He further emphasized that he wanted to make the contract based on the standard regulations of art industry for the benefits of artists. |
